Course Overview
This course builds on the fundamentals taught in INTD 2300, Residential Design Studio A. An emphasis will be on understanding space and planning with architectural features including a variety of wall types, ceilings, doors, windows, fireplaces, and staircases. Students will plan a comprehensive residential space, working through the typical phases of a design project including design programming, concept development, product research, planning, and design development. Students will present their design solutions both visually and through oral communication. They will also demonstrate their 2D AutoCAD skills and use their freehand or SketchUp skills for any 3D components in their final submission.

Learning Outcomes
Upon successful completion of this course, the student will be able to:
- Analyze project requirements and produce accurate programs and adjacencies.
- Create design solutions that meet program requirements for a residential two-story space.
- Select appropriate materials and finishes considering factors such as sustainability, functionality, aesthetics, durability and the unique requirements of select spaces.
- Produce freehand plans and layouts to scale during the planning and design development process.
- Demonstrate an understanding of plumbing infrastructure in layouts for a residential space.
- Incorporate architectural features such as walls, doors, windows, staircases, and fireplaces to provide a functional solution following the elements and principles of design.
- Select appropriate furniture for suitable applications and incorporate it into a floor plan at the appropriate scale.
- Identify appropriate appliances, plumbing fixtures, and fittings and incorporate them into plans.
- Design ceiling treatments considering factors such as spatial proportions, lighting, finishes and overall relationship to planned space and concept.
- Incorporate accurate stair calculations and layouts.
- Explore and manipulate the volume of a residential space.
- Develop a sketchbook/process journal showing research, concept, and design development through sketching 2-D and 3-D.
- Create a full design concept package communicating design process for a comprehensive residential interior.
- Demonstrate skills in AutoCAD, 3-D representation and graphic presentation throughout the project.
